Question : ocassionally I feel pressure around my temples and around towards the back of my head. I have a history of high blood pressure but has been under control via medication. I am concenrned about this new symptom

Brief Answer:
Possible diagnosis: Tension headache

Detailed Answer:
Hello,
Thank you for trusting HealthcareMagic

Your symptoms are suggestive of tension headache. Tension headache is caused due to stress.
Here are few things to try to help relieve the symptoms
-Avoid stress. Practice relaxation techniques like exercise, meditation etc.
-Get adequate sleep and rest
-Limit screen time including computer, television
-When you experience pressure/pain take tylenol(if not allergic)
-Keep a head ache diary and identify any triggering factors.

I would also recommend your blood pressure levels checked.
